日本NCRコマース

retail, restaurant, digital banking

プラットフォームエンジニア

Tokyo, Japan FULL TIME
Market Sentiment
HIGH DEMAND

Neural analysis suggests this role is
optimal for Mid+ candidates.

The Brief

“プラットフォームエンジニア at 日本NCRコマース. Skills: server-side development, microservices development, API design and development, cloud services. server-side development for next-generation POS systems. applying next-generation software development principles, theories, and concepts”

What You'll Achieve.

accelerating new possibilities in retail, restaurant operations, experiences, and business outcomes; driving digital transformation

Industry & Context.

retail, restaurant, digital banking
Problems you'll solve

problem-solving ability

What They're Looking For.

Must Have

Java, Python, Go, PHP, C#, shell script, Node.js, SQL, MySQL, PostgreSQL, SQL Server, Oracle, NoSQL, BigQuery, MongoDB, RESTful API, GraphQL, data protection, authentication, authorization, encryption, Google Cloud, AWS, Azure, Git, unit testing, integration testing, debugging, GitHub Copilot, code generation, code improvement, bug investigation, performance optimization, basic network protocols, infrastructure understanding, problem-solving ability, communication ability, teamwork, Japanese language proficiency, English communication ability

Nice to Have

POS solutions for retail, food, and drug stores (payments, loyalty, promotions, etc.)

What You'll Do.

server-side development for next-generation POS systems

applying next-generation software development principles

scaling system performance

understanding requirements

enhancing existing software

developing microservices on digital retail's latest software stack using various programming languages and cloud technologies

developing next-generation products based on requirements from product management and engineering

How You'll Work.

Team & Collaboration

collaborating with engineering teams; collaborating with product management and engineering

Communication Scope

communication ability; English communication ability

Full Job Description

**日本NCRコマースについて** 日本NCRコマースは、小売、レストラン、デジタルバンキングのお客様をテクノロジーの力で支援する グローバルサービス プロバイダーです。柔軟でインテリジェントなプラットフォームと、豊富な業界経験に基づいて開発されたエンドツーエンドの決済機能およびサービスを組み合わせることで、小売、レストランのオペレーション、体験、そしてビジネスの成果における新たな可能性の加速を実現します。 日本NCRコマースは世界約35か国以上でビジネスを展開するNCR Voyix(NYSE: VYX)のグループカンパニーとして、グローバルの知見と経験、専門知識でデジタルトランスフォーメーションを推進しています。 ■ 業務内容 次世代POSシステムのサーバーサイド開発。最新のソフトウェア開発原則、理論、概念を適用して、設計、コーディング、システムパフォーマンスのスケーリング、および問題解決において重要な役割を果たします。 この役割は、要件の理解、既存ソフトウェアの強化、および各種プログラミング言語、クラウド技術を使用したデジタル小売の最新ソフトウェアスタックでのマイクロサービスの開発を必要とします。また、エンジニアリングチームと協力して、製品管理およびエンジニアリングからの要件に基づいて、次世代製品を開発します。 ■ 必要な能力・経験 【必須】 * プログラミング言語: Java, Python, Go, PHP, C#, shell script, Node.jsなどのサーバーサイド言語に精通していること * データベース管理: SQL(MySQL, PostgreSQL, SQL Server, Oracle)やNoSQL(BigQuery, MongoDB)データベースの知識と経験があること * API設計と開発: RESTful APIやGraphQLの設計と実装に関するスキルがあること * セキュリティ: データ保護、認証、認可、暗号化などのセキュリティ対策に関する知識があること * クラウドサービス: Google Cloud, AWS, Azureなどのクラウドプラットフォームの利用経験があること * バージョン管理: Gitなどのバージョン管理ツールの使用経験があること * テストとデバッグ: ユニットテスト、統合テスト、デバッグのスキルがあること * AI: GitHub Copilot などの生成AIを用いて、コード生成・改善・テストや不具合調査を行い、生産性と品質を高められること * パフォーマンス最適化: サーバーのパフォーマンスを最適化するための知識と経験があること * ネットワークの知識: 基本的なネットワークプロトコルやインフラストラクチャの理解があること * ソフトスキル: 問題解決能力、コミュニケーション能力、チームワーク 【歓迎】 * リテール・食品・ドラッグストア向けPOSソリューション(決済、ロイヤルティ、プロモーション等)の経験 ■ 語学 * 日本語:必須 * 英語:コミュニケーションが取れること EEOステートメント 私たちの共通の価値観に統合されているのは、NCRの多様性への取り組みです。 NCRは、すべての人々が公正に扱われ、個性があると認められ、業績に基づいて推進され、最大限の可能性に達するよう努力することを奨励される、グローバルに包括的な企業であることを約束します。私たちはすべての人々の違いを理解し、尊重することを信じています。 NCRは、性別、年齢、人種、肌の色、信条、宗教、出身国、身体障害、性的指向、ベテランの地位、兵役、遺伝情報、または法律で保護されているその他の特性に基づいて雇用を差別しません。 NCRの各個人は、世界的に多様な環境を尊重し支援する継続的な責任を負っています。 第三者機関への声明 すべての人材紹介会社に:NCRは、NCR優先サプライヤーリストに記載されている企業からの履歴書のみを受け付けます。履歴書を応募者追跡システム、NCRの従業員、またはNCRの施設に転送しないでください。 NCRは、求められていない履歴書に関連する料金または費用について一切責任を負いません。

Free ATS check

Applying for this プラットフォームエンジニア role?

Most applicants get filtered before a human reads their resume. See if yours makes the cut.

How to Apply on Workday

  • Workday has a multi-step form — save your progress after every section.
  • "Apply With LinkedIn" can fail or lose data; manual entry is more reliable.
  • Watch for the "Submit for Review" final step — hitting "Save" alone does not submit.
  • Job requisition numbers are useful when following up with HR by email.

ANONYMOUS · UNFILTERED

What do employees actually say about 日本NCRコマース?

Real rants from real employees. Read before you apply.

Read Company Rants →